Ticket: Signature verification failing on FareTrial plugin uploads

Several external plugin authors report that bundles built against the FareTrial pricing-experiment SDK fail the signature check at upload. We traced this to last week's rotation: the verifier now only accepts artifacts signed with the current release key. Please re-sign your plugin packages before resubmitting. For convenience, the active public signing key is included below.

release key, hadug-kawef: bky13_mPGeFZeR1GZ1G

Ticket #FAC-2291 — Floor 6 Opening. Heads up, contractors: the new sixth floor at Wrenfield Tower opens Monday, so fit-out crews can finally use the proper lifts instead of the goods hoist. Sign in at the Level 1 desk as usual and grab a yellow pass. The stairwell door to Floor 6 stays coded for now — use the code below.

turnstile pass: bdg-TXR-4

Meeting notes — Lantern & Rook tour, props session (excerpt)

Quick recap: the collapsible throne and the fake stained-glass panels are done and crated. Marva wants the foam gargoyles padded better after the Dunmoor leg scuffed two of them — sorted, double bubble wrap this time. Crates go out with Pellway Freight on Monday and should reach the Ostbridge venue by Wednesday load-in. Don't open crate 4 until the rigging team is present; it's top-heavy. For the courier hand-over at the dock, follow the instruction below.

handover note for yagef-bagep: the drudor pelius courier leaves the kasdor zorvan norir ledger at gate 8016 under passcode 755406